Make latex finally work to some extent

This commit is contained in:
David Holland 2020-05-19 03:15:24 +02:00
parent 6cd999151a
commit 4571e2eab9
Signed by: DustVoice
GPG Key ID: 47068995A14EDCA9
1 changed files with 16 additions and 19 deletions

View File

@ -107,13 +107,13 @@ let g:use_livedown = 0
let g:use_nerdcommenter = 1 let g:use_nerdcommenter = 1
let g:use_nerdtree = 1 let g:use_nerdtree = 1
let g:use_pandoc = 0 let g:use_pandoc = 0
let g:use_polyglot = 1 let g:use_polyglot = 0
let g:use_python = 1 let g:use_python = 1
let g:use_sound = 0 let g:use_sound = 0
let g:use_sxhkd = 1 let g:use_sxhkd = 1
let g:use_templator = 0 let g:use_templator = 0
let g:use_utf8 = 1 let g:use_utf8 = 1
let g:use_vimtex = 0 let g:use_vimtex = 1
let g:ycm_clang = '' let g:ycm_clang = ''
let g:ycm_confirm_extra_conf = 0 let g:ycm_confirm_extra_conf = 0
let g:ycm_filetype_whitelist = {'cpp': 1} let g:ycm_filetype_whitelist = {'cpp': 1}
@ -418,7 +418,6 @@ let $NVIM_TUI_ENABLE_TRUE_COLOR=1
" Disable polyglot for latex files " Disable polyglot for latex files
" === " ===
if g:use_polyglot == 1 if g:use_polyglot == 1
let g:polyglot_disabled = ['latex']
let g:vim_markdown_conceal = 0 let g:vim_markdown_conceal = 0
endif endif
" === " ===
@ -427,24 +426,22 @@ endif
" Setup vimtex " Setup vimtex
" === " ===
if g:use_vimtex == 1 if g:use_vimtex == 1
let g:vimtex_compiler_latexmk = { let g:polyglot_disabled = ['latex', 'tex']
\ 'backend' : 'nvim',
\ 'background' : 1, let g:tex_flavor='latex'
\ 'build_dir' : '', let g:vimtex_syntax_autoload_packages = ['hyperref', 'listings', 'luacode', 'minted']
\ 'callback' : 1, let g:vimtex_format_enabled = 1
\ 'continuous' : 0, let g:vimtex_indent_enabled = 1
\ 'executable' : 'latexmk',
\ 'options' : [ "let g:vimtex_indent_ignored_envs = ['document']
\ '-verbose', "let g:vimtex_syntax_minted = [{'lang':'text'}, {'lang':'console'}]
\ '-file-line-error',
\ '-synctex=1', let g:vimtex_compiler_latexmk = {'backend':'nvim', 'background':0, 'build_dir':'', 'callback':1, 'continuous':0, 'executable':'latexmk', 'options':['-verbose', '-file-line-error', '-shell-escape']}
\ '-interaction=nonstopmode', "let g:vimtex_compiler_latexmk = {'backend':'nvim', 'background':1, 'build_dir':'', 'callback':1, 'continuous':1, 'executable':'latexmk', 'options':['-verbose', '-file-line-error', '-synctex=1', '-interaction=nonstopmode', '-lualatex', '-shell-escape']}
\ '-shell-escape',
\ ],
\}
let g:vimtex_quickfix_mode = 1 let g:vimtex_quickfix_mode = 1
let g:vimtex_quickfix_open_on_warning = 0 let g:vimtex_quickfix_open_on_warning = 0
if g:platform ==? "windows" || g:platform ==? "windows_portable" if g:platform ==? "windows" || g:platform ==? "windows_portable"
let g:vimtex_view_enabled = 1 let g:vimtex_view_enabled = 1
let g:vimtex_view_general_viewer = 'SumatraPDF' let g:vimtex_view_general_viewer = 'SumatraPDF'
@ -458,7 +455,7 @@ if g:use_vimtex == 1
let g:vimtex_view_general_viewer = '' let g:vimtex_view_general_viewer = ''
endif endif
let g:vimtex_fold_enabled=1 "let g:vimtex_fold_enabled=1
endif endif
" === " ===